Table of methods by purpose

The following is a table of methods (and their variants) for solving various twisty puzzles. Follow the links to read more about each method or the methods in the category.

Name Original Proposer(s) Variants
2x2
2x2 Beginner
LBL Waterman Last Layer
Beginner Guimond Conrad Rider
2x2 Speed
CLL Various
NMCLL Gilles Roux, James Straughan
EG Erik Akkersdijk, Gunnar Krig EG-1, EG-2
Guimond Gaétan Guimond
Ortega Victor Ortega,
Josef Jelinek, Jeff Varasano
PBL
SS Mitchell Stern, Timothy Sun
OFOTA Erik Akkersdijk
VOP Kenneth Gustavsson
TCLL Robert Yau, Christopher Olson, and others CLL
HD V. Higgs, J. Demars, Max Garza, John Lewis VOP
3x3
3x3 Beginner
LBL
Ortega/Mcetsu Jeff Varasano
Corners First Marc Waterman
Less is More Camilo Amaral
"The Ideal Solution" Ideal Toy Corp
Edges First
8355 Reheart Sheu Sexy Method, MirIS Method
Edge Supertwist Method David Ha
3x3 speed Beginner
Beginner Petrus
335 Robbie Safran
Beginner Roux
Beginner CFOP Badmephisto
Pogobat Beginner Method Dan Brown
Keyhole
XG OLL, PLL
Samsara Method OLL, PLL
Lazy CFOP Alex Yang CFOP, Roux, Petrus, CFCE, ZZ, Columns, LBL, FreeFOP, WV, Salvia, Snyder
3x3 Speed
Pizel method Alexandre Philiponet
Ribbon Method Justin Taylor F2L-1 Corner, TOLS, TTLL
Russo method Anthony Russo F2L-1 Cross Edge, CLL, EO, L5EP
ZZ Zbigniew Zborowski ZZ-VH, ZZ-a, ZZ-b, ZZ-d,
ZZ-WV, MGLS-Z, ZZ-blah, EJLS, JTLE, ZBLL
Waterman Marc Waterman
Tripod Michael Gottlieb F2L, 2x2 Block, 2x2x3 Block
Sledgehog Ryan Vigil CFOP, Tripod
L2L Duncan Dicks, Stachu Korick
Hahn Eric Hahn
Hexagonal Francisco Andrew Nathenson
Quadrangular Francisco Alex Yang
LMCF Eric Fattah
WaterRoux
CFOP (Fridrich) David Singmaster
René Schoof
Jessica Fridrich
Hans Dockhorn
Anneke Treep
VH, ZB, MGLS-F, OLL, PLL, F2L
CFCE CLL/ELL
FreeFOP Petrus, CFOP
Columns First Methods Roux, CFOP, Shadowslice
3x3 Speed/FMC
Petrus Lars Petrus JTLE, EJLS, MGLS-P
Roux Gilles Roux
Heise Ryan Heise
Snyder Anthony Snyder
SSC (Shadowslice Snow Columns) Joseph Briggs
B2 (Briggs2) Method (Briggs/B2)
LEOR Arc, Pyjam EO, ZBLL
3x3 BLD
3OP John White?
Old Pochmann Stefan Pochmann
M2/R2 Stefan Pochmann Deadalnix (M2),
Freestyle for Dummies (R2)
TuRBo Erik Akkersdijk
BH Daniel Beyer,
Chris Hardwick
ZBLD Chris Tran ZBLD-2Cycle, ZBLD-3Cycle
Big Cubes
n×n×n / Universal
Ofapel method Guillaume Erbibou
Big Cubes Speed
Yau method Robert Yau
Hoya method Jong-Ho Jeong
Obli Method Alex Yang
Reduction
OBLBL
NS4
4Z4 Joseph Tudor
Cage Per Kristen Fredlund
Meyer method Richard Meyer
K4 Thom Barlow
Sandwich Nicholas Ho
Kenneth's Big Cubes Method Kenneth Gustavsson
Z4 Conrad Rider
js4 ??
4trus Owen Smith
Lewis Method John Lewis
Pet5 Isabel S.
Big Cubes BLD
r2 Erik Akkersdijk
BH Daniel Beyer,
Chris Hardwick
Other puzzles
Experimental
Human Thistlethwaite Morwen Thistlethwaite
Ryan Heise
Belt Various
CML-Method [Various]
Salvia Method David Salvia
Triangular Francisco Michael Gottlieb
Hexagonal Francisco Andrew Nathenson, Henry Helmuth
Quadrangular Francisco Alex Yang
Orient First Lars Nielsson
HSC Imam Tanvin Alam
2GB Imam Tanvin Alam
E15 / E35 ??
Zagorec method Damjan Zagorec
3CFCEP ??
3CFCE ??
PEG ??
PORT ??
FRED Baian Liu, Timothy Sun, Stachu Korick
VDW Method Alex VanDerWyst
Hawaiian Kociemba Michael Humuhumunukunukuapua'a HKOLL, HKPLL, EO,
Pikas**t Justin Harder
Poux Alex Yang
R3-T Terence Tan
Pyraminx
Corners First ??
Layer First ??
Last 4 Edges ??
Petrus ??
Face Permute ??
WO Oscar Roth Andersen (Odder)
Oka Method Yohei Oka
Megaminx
Balint method Balint Bodor
keyhole method
S2L Westlund Style Simon Westlund
S2L+T2L--->Multiple F2L (Virus S2L) Yu Da Hyun
Square-1
SSS1M Shelley Chang
Vandenbergh Method Lars Vandenbergh
Roux n Skrew
Skwuction Jaap Scherphuis, Cary Huang
Yoyleberry Cary Huang
Lin
Rubik's Clock
...
Magic
...
Master Magic
Pochmann Method Stefan Pochmann
Ooms Alexander Ooms
Skewb
Sarah method Sarah Strong LBL, 1LLL
Ranzha method Brandon Harnish Petrus Block, Welder mask, PUC (Permuting U corners), LFC(Last Four Centers), CLL
Frisk Method Alex Yang Winter Variation, EG-2
Skrouxb Ben Pang
1 Algorithm method ?? FBF (Face by Face), CLL
Kirjava-Meep Method Kirjava-Meep CLL, EG, L5C, TCLL
Rubik's 360
...
